Best Version to Get

The mid-level SV trim is a good place to start, since it brings an eight-way power driver's seat, keyless entry and push-button start, optional dual-zone automatic climate control and optional heated front seats. 

All-wheel-drive should be considered if driven on snowy roads often.

About Consumer Reports

Consumer Reports puts people first. For more than 80 years, CR has provided consumers with independent research, ratings and recommendations to help make good purchase decisions. As a nonprofit consumer testing and advocacy organization, CR works with businesses and government to improve the safety, performance, value and reliability of products and services.

Every year CR puts manufacturer claims to the test for thousands of products, from cars and appliances to baby products and sunscreens. CR purchases all the products that we test and uses scientific research methods to develop our ratings.
